Hyaloscypha
Joaquin Martin, 10-02-2017 15:19
Hi,

I found this Hyaloscypha on worked wood.
Size of Apothecia 0.3-0.6 mm. and the spores (9.3) 9.8 - 13.1 (14.5) × (2.3) 2.6 - 3.2 (3.4)
I think H.britannica but it hasn't yellow drops on hairs

Hans-Otto Baral, 10-02-2017 16:11
Hans-Otto Baral
Re : Hyaloscypha
Maybe the hair tips are too narrow for britannica/aureliella. Did you see croziers?
Joaquin Martin, 10-02-2017 16:52
Re : Hyaloscypha
Hi,

No, I didn't see croziers.
  • message #47154
Hans-Otto Baral, 10-02-2017 16:55
Hans-Otto Baral
Re : Hyaloscypha
This is without indeed. H. britannica/aureliella must have croziers, so it is another species. Perhaps H. spiralis.
